[prev in list] [next in list] [prev in thread] [next in thread] 

List:       gluster-devel
Subject:    [Gluster-devel] Opinions on ideal time for gerrit downtime
From:       Nigel Babu <nigelb () redhat ! com>
Date:       2016-05-25 11:14:36
Message-ID: CAF2NqgM09axhHtckkH3W2+9YF4b_XiC-FehLce_FVBHpLDPcEg () mail ! gmail ! com
[Download RAW message or body]

[Attachment #2 (multipart/alternative)]


Hello folks,

I'd like to bring down gerrit for 2 hours some time next week to migrate
our database from H2 to PostgreSQL. This will start us on the path to
scaling gerrit better. This migration will also speed up the process of
upgrading gerrit to the latest version and having our install running newer
releases of gerrit quickly.

There is really no good time to bring down an essential service like
gerrit. My proposal is Monday 0230[1] UTC or 1230[2] UTC. I've looked at
our git punchcards and it's a reasonably quiet time to bring down gerrit
for maintenance.

In the meanwhile, I'd appreciate some feedback on review.nigelb.me which is
a snapshot of our gerrit instance from this morning but with the database
powered by postgres. I'd appreciate feedback that the permissions work as
expected and reviewing works as expected. This instance does not replicate
to github, so feel free to push commits to test.

I do not expect this migration to cause any data loss whatsoever (help in
testing review.nigelb.me appreciated!). I'm taking great pains to make sure
the data is transferred over perfectly. In case we run into any problems
during migration, we can fall back to our H2 database pretty instantly.

During the migration window, gerrit will be completely down. I will send in
an email before the start and after the successful completion of the
migration.

[1]
http://www.timeanddate.com/worldclock/fixedtime.html?msg=Maintenance&iso=20160530T08&p1=176&ah=2
[2]
http://www.timeanddate.com/worldclock/fixedtime.html?msg=Maintenance&iso=20160530T18&p1=176&ah=2

-- 
nigelb

[Attachment #5 (text/html)]

<div dir="ltr"><div><div><div>Hello folks,<br><br></div>I&#39;d like to bring down \
gerrit for 2 hours some time next week to migrate our database from H2 to PostgreSQL. \
This will start us on the path to scaling gerrit better. This migration will also \
speed up the process of upgrading gerrit to the  latest version and having our \
install running newer releases of  gerrit quickly.<br><br>There is really no good \
time to bring down an essential service like gerrit. My proposal is Monday 0230[1] \
UTC or 1230[2] UTC. I&#39;ve looked at our git punchcards and it&#39;s a reasonably \
quiet time to bring down gerrit for maintenance.<br><br></div>In the meanwhile, \
I&#39;d appreciate some feedback on <a \
href="http://review.nigelb.me">review.nigelb.me</a> which is a snapshot of our gerrit \
instance from this morning but with the database powered by postgres. I&#39;d \
appreciate feedback that the permissions work as expected and reviewing works as \
expected. This instance does not replicate to github, so feel free to push commits to \
test.<br><br></div><div>I do not expect this migration to cause any data loss \
whatsoever (help in testing <a href="http://review.nigelb.me">review.nigelb.me</a> \
appreciated!). I&#39;m taking great pains to make sure the data is transferred over \
perfectly. In case we run into any problems during migration, we can fall back to our \
H2 database pretty instantly.<br><br></div><div>During the migration window, gerrit \
will be completely down. I will send in an email before the start and after the \
successful completion of the migration.<br></div><div><div><div><br>[1] <a \
href="http://www.timeanddate.com/worldclock/fixedtime.html?msg=Maintenance&amp;iso=201 \
60530T08&amp;p1=176&amp;ah=2">http://www.timeanddate.com/worldclock/fixedtime.html?msg=Maintenance&amp;iso=20160530T08&amp;p1=176&amp;ah=2</a><br>[2] \
<a href="http://www.timeanddate.com/worldclock/fixedtime.html?msg=Maintenance&amp;iso= \
20160530T18&amp;p1=176&amp;ah=2">http://www.timeanddate.com/worldclock/fixedtime.html?msg=Maintenance&amp;iso=20160530T18&amp;p1=176&amp;ah=2</a><br \
clear="all"><div><div><br>-- <br><div class="gmail_signature"><div \
dir="ltr">nigelb<br></div></div> </div></div></div></div></div></div>



_______________________________________________
Gluster-devel mailing list
Gluster-devel@gluster.org
http://www.gluster.org/mailman/listinfo/gluster-devel

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ic